Xbox console discounts and deals have been nonexistent lately

The Xbox Series X originally cost $500 when it came out in November 2020, but its price has increased significantly over the past year.
Microsoft has increased the price of its consoles in the U.S. twice, due to tariffs imposed during the Trump administration on the countries where its parts are made.
Now, the standard Xbox Series X costs a surprising $650. The white, all-digital version, which doesn’t have a disc drive, is $50 cheaper.
Xbox didn’t offer any official Black Friday discounts this year. The price of both the Xbox Series X and Series S consoles remained the same, even with recent price increases.

Does the Xbox Series X have a disc drive?
That depends on which Xbox Series X you choose. The black version and the special 2TB “Galaxy” version both play physical games, movies, and TV shows using a disc drive. However, the white version doesn’t have a disc drive and is designed for digital downloads only.
Can you expand the storage on the Xbox Series X?
Absolutely! You can use a standard USB hard drive for games not specifically designed for the newest Xbox Series X|S consoles. However, if a game *is* optimized for Series X|S, you’ll need to use the official storage expansion card, like the Seagate Xbox Storage Expansion Card.
What is Cyber Monday?
Cyber Monday was originally created as an online response to the in-store sales of Black Friday. However, the two shopping events have become so intertwined that Cyber Monday now largely functions as a continuation of the Black Friday discounts.
